Veer-Zaara is a 2004 Indian romantic drama film directed by Yash Chopra, a renowned Indian filmmaker. The film stars Shah Rukh Khan and Preity Zinta in the lead roles. The movie's narrative revolves around the themes of love, separation, and the power of true love to transcend borders and time.
